Jane Austen’s Books: A Guide

Jane Austen, the renowned author of "Pride and Prejudice," is celebrated for her insightful portrayal of class and romance in 19th-century England. Despite her relatively small literary output, Austen's work has endured and remains remarkably relevant to modern readers, more than two centuries after her passing. Austen's novels, which include timeless classics such as "Sense and Sensibility," "Emma," and "Persuasion," are renowned for their sharp wit, nuanced character development, and keen social observations. Her work offers a captivating glimpse into the intricate social dynamics and customs of the Regency era, while also exploring universal themes of love, relationships, and personal growth. Austen's enduring popularity can be attributed to her ability to create complex, relatable characters and to explore the complexities of human nature with depth and insight. Her work continues to inspire adaptations, scholarly analyses, and devoted fan communities, underscoring the timeless appeal of her literary contributions.
